Buying apartments in Nairobi for rental income is one of the most practical ways to build long-term property value. Nairobi remains Kenya’s strongest real estate market because it attracts professionals, families, students, expatriates, corporate tenants, diaspora buyers and business owners.

However, not every apartment in Nairobi is a good rental investment.

At Realty Boris, we advise investors to buy apartments based on tenant demand, location strength, unit layout, management quality, service charge, rental strategy and resale value. A good rental apartment should not only look attractive during viewing. It should be easy to rent, easy to maintain, easy to manage and strong enough to hold long-term value.

Many buyers make the mistake of choosing an apartment only because the price looks affordable or the building has attractive finishes. Rental income depends on more than price. It depends on whether real tenants want to live there and whether the property can remain competitive over time.

What Makes an Apartment Good for Rental Income?

A strong rental apartment should meet a clear tenant need.

Before buying, investors should ask:

  • Who will rent this apartment?
  • Why would they choose this location?
  • What rent can the unit realistically achieve?
  • Is the service charge reasonable?
  • Is the building well managed?
  • Is parking available?
  • Is water reliable?
  • Is security strong?
  • Can the unit resell well later?
  • Is the apartment suitable for furnished or unfurnished rental?

At Realty Boris, we advise investors to avoid buying blindly. A rental apartment should be selected with a clear tenant profile in mind.

A property with strong rental income potential usually has:

  • Good location
  • Practical layout
  • Secure parking
  • Reliable water supply
  • Strong security
  • Professional management
  • Reasonable service charge
  • Access to amenities
  • Good road access
  • Strong tenant demand
  • Clean documentation
  • Resale appeal

Rental income is not only about how much rent you collect. It is also about occupancy, maintenance, tenant quality and long-term value.

Studio Apartments for Rental Income

Studio apartments are often attractive to first-time investors because the entry price is usually lower than larger units.

They can attract:

  • Young professionals
  • Students
  • Consultants
  • Short-stay tenants
  • Single occupants
  • Budget-conscious tenants
  • Furnished rental guests

Strong studio apartment locations may include Kilimani, Westlands, Upper Hill, Parklands and selected parts of Kileleshwa depending on the building and target tenant.

At Realty Boris, we advise investors to be careful with studio apartments. They can rent well when properly located, but oversupply can affect performance in some areas.

Before buying a studio, check:

  • Unit size
  • Natural lighting
  • Kitchen functionality
  • Bathroom quality
  • Parking availability
  • Building rules
  • Furnished rental demand
  • Service charge
  • Competition nearby

A studio apartment should feel practical, not squeezed.

3 Bedroom Apartments for Rental Income

3 bedroom apartments usually target families, executives and long-term tenants.

They are suitable for buyers who want more stable tenancy and larger monthly rental income.

Strong areas for 3 bedroom apartments include:

  • Kileleshwa
  • Lavington
  • Riverside
  • Kilimani
  • Westlands
  • Parklands
  • Brookside
  • Upper Hill

At Realty Boris, we advise investors to study tenant demand carefully before buying a 3 bedroom apartment.

Larger apartments may have higher rent, but they can also have higher service charge, higher maintenance cost and a narrower tenant pool compared to 1 bedroom or 2 bedroom units.

A good 3 bedroom rental apartment should be spacious, well located, secure and suitable for family living.

Furnished Apartments for Rental Income

Furnished apartments can offer strong income potential in the right location, but they require active management.

They may attract:

  • Business travellers
  • Consultants
  • Expatriates
  • Corporate guests
  • Diaspora visitors
  • Short-stay professionals
  • Relocating tenants
  • Medical visitors
  • NGO staff

Strong furnished apartment areas include:

  • Westlands
  • Kilimani
  • Riverside
  • Upper Hill
  • Kileleshwa
  • Lavington
  • Parklands

At Realty Boris, we advise buyers to treat furnished rental as an operating investment.

The apartment must be properly furnished, photographed, maintained, cleaned and managed. Utilities, internet, linen, appliances, repairs and guest communication must also be handled professionally.

Before buying for furnished rental, confirm whether the building allows short-stay or furnished rentals.

A furnished strategy can work well, but only when the building, location and management support it.

Kilimani

Kilimani is one of Nairobi’s most active apartment markets.

It attracts young professionals, investors, furnished rental tenants, consultants, couples and small families.

Kilimani works well for:

  • Studio apartments
  • 1 bedroom apartments
  • 2 bedroom apartments
  • 3 bedroom apartments
  • Furnished apartments

The area is attractive because of access to Yaya Centre, Ngong Road, Upper Hill, Lavington, Kileleshwa and Nairobi CBD.

At Realty Boris, we advise investors to be selective in Kilimani because there are many developments. Building quality, parking, service charge, water supply and management standards matter.

A good Kilimani apartment should be well located and easy to rent.

Westlands

Westlands is one of Nairobi’s strongest rental investment areas because it combines business, lifestyle and corporate demand.

It attracts:

  • Corporate tenants
  • Expatriates
  • Consultants
  • Business travellers
  • Young executives
  • Furnished rental clients
  • Professionals working nearby

Westlands works well for:

  • 1 bedroom apartments
  • 2 bedroom apartments
  • Furnished apartments
  • Serviced apartments
  • Penthouses

At Realty Boris, we advise investors to consider Westlands when targeting executive and corporate tenants.

The exact pocket matters. Central Westlands, Brookside, Rhapta Road, General Mathenge and Muthangari can perform differently.

A strong Westlands apartment should offer security, parking, convenience and reliable management.

How to Choose Between 1 Bedroom and 2 Bedroom Apartments

Many investors ask whether a 1 bedroom or 2 bedroom apartment is better for rental income.

A 1 bedroom apartment may be better if the buyer wants:

  • Lower entry price
  • Easier furnishing
  • Manageable maintenance
  • Strong demand from professionals
  • Furnished rental potential

A 2 bedroom apartment may be better if the buyer wants:

  • Wider tenant pool
  • More flexibility
  • Appeal to couples and small families
  • Work-from-home use
  • Better long-term resale appeal

At Realty Boris, we advise buyers to compare both options based on location and rental strategy.

In Westlands and Riverside, 1 bedroom apartments can perform well for executive tenants. In Kileleshwa and Lavington, 2 bedroom apartments may offer stronger long-term rental appeal. In Kilimani, both can work depending on building quality and target tenant.

The best option depends on your budget and investment goal.

What Investors Should Check Before Buying

Before buying an apartment for rental income, investors should check:

  • Location
  • Unit type
  • Purchase price
  • Expected rent
  • Service charge
  • Parking
  • Water supply
  • Power backup
  • Security
  • Building management
  • Amenities
  • Tenant demand
  • Furnished rental rules
  • Maintenance cost
  • Resale value
  • Legal documents
  • Developer reputation where applicable

At Realty Boris, we advise investors to calculate rental income realistically.

Do not only look at gross rent. Consider vacancy, repairs, service charge, management fees, furnishing cost and future maintenance.

A good rental investment should make sense after costs.

Common Mistakes Rental Investors Should Avoid

Many investors make mistakes because they focus on projected income without checking fundamentals.

Avoid these mistakes:

  • Buying only because the price is low
  • Ignoring service charge
  • Overestimating rent
  • Not checking building management
  • Ignoring parking
  • Assuming furnished rentals are allowed
  • Buying a poor layout
  • Not checking water and power reliability
  • Ignoring tenant demand
  • Not comparing similar units
  • Buying without legal due diligence
  • Forgetting maintenance costs
  • Ignoring resale value
  • Not planning property management
  • Buying under pressure

At Realty Boris, our advice is to buy the apartment that tenants will choose repeatedly.

Rental income comes from consistent demand, not just attractive marketing.
